The Standard Formulas for Tank Shapes
Many aquariums are geometric shapes. By determining the inside measurements of the tank (length, width, and height) in inches, Fish Tank Volume Calculator Gallons keepers can compute the volume in cubic inches and transform it into gallons or liters.
1. Rectangle-shaped Aquariums
The most common tank shape is the rectangle-shaped prism.
- Formula: ₤ text Volume (gallons) = frac text Length times text Width times text Height 231 ₤
- Why 231? There are 231 cubic inches in a standard U.S. liquid gallon.
2. Round Aquariums
Column or round tanks are popular for their 360-degree watching angles, but their volume needs the formula for the volume of a cylinder.
- Formula: ₤ text Volume (gallons) = frac pi times r ^ 2 times text Height 231 ₤
- ( Note: ₤ r ₤ is the radius, which is half of the cylinder's size).
3. Bow-Front Aquariums
Bow-front tanks have a curved front glass that increases the volume slightly compared to a basic rectangular tank of the same footprint.
- Formula: ₤ text Volume (gallons) = frac ( text Flat Width + text Max Width) div 2 times text Length times text Height 231 ₤

One of the most typical pitfalls in the Aquarium Gallons Calculator pastime is confusing tank capability with actual water volume.
When a tank is filled, several aspects use up physical area inside the glass, displacing water. For that reason, a tank rated for 50 gallons will rarely hold a complete 50 gallons of water.
Elements That Reduce Actual Water Volume:
- Substrate: Gravel, sand, and aqusoil layers can take up anywhere from 5% to 15% of the total tank volume.
- Hardscape: Large rocks, driftwood, and ceramic designs displace substantial quantities of water.
- Equipment: Internal filters, heating units, and air stones minimize the liquid capability.
- Unfavorable Space: Most enthusiasts do not fill their tanks to the outright brim; a basic safety margin leaves about 1 to 2 inches of area at the top.
As a general rule of thumb, subtract 10% to 15% from the computed geometric volume to discover the true water volume of a heavily decorated tank.
Step-by-Step Guide to Calculating Actual Water Volume
For those who want to be 100% accurate, follow this step-by-step approach during the initial fill-up:
- Measure the Empty Tank: Measure the interior length, width, and height in inches and use the formula to find the maximum possible capability.
- Represent the Substrate and Hardscape: Once the substrate and designs remain in location, measure the height of the water line from the bottom of the tank (instead of the total height of the glass).
- Use the Water Line Calculation: Recalculate using the water height instead of the glass height:₤ ₤ text Actual Volume = frac text Length times text Width times text Water Height 231 ₤ ₤
- The Bucket Method (Alternative): For irregularly shaped tanks, the most precise approach is to fill the tank utilizing a marked container (like a 1-gallon or 5-gallon pail), keeping a rigorous count of the number of gallons are gathered until it reaches the preferred level.
Necessary Tips for Success
To make sure accuracy and security when dealing with Calculate Aquarium Capacity capabilities, keep these best practices in mind:
- Always step from the inside: Measuring the beyond the glass consists of the density of the glass panels, which can toss off the estimation by a gallon or more on larger tanks.
- Convert Metric easily: If working in centimeters, use the metric formula (₤ text Length times text Width times text Height in cm div 1000 = text Liters ₤). To convert liters to U.S. gallons, divide the overall liters by 3.785.
